The Unique Demands of Aquatic Emergency Response

A cardiac emergency on dry land is serious. A submersion incident at a pool or waterfront adds an entirely different layer of complexity that standard CPR courses simply do not address. Understanding this distinction is the first step toward appreciating why lifeguard-specific CPR training exists as its own category of professional preparation.

When a swimmer goes under, the physiological situation is often different from a typical witnessed cardiac arrest on land. Submersion incidents frequently result in hypoxic cardiac arrest, meaning the heart stops because the body has been deprived of oxygen, rather than due to a primary cardiac event. This distinction matters because rescue breathing becomes especially critical in aquatic CPR scenarios. Some bystander CPR guidance emphasizes compression-only CPR for witnessed cardiac arrest, but for drowning victims, ventilation is not optional. It is central to any chance of survival.

Then there are the physical realities of the aquatic environment itself. Before a lifeguard can even begin chest compressions, they have had to spot the victim, enter the water, perform the actual rescue, and extract the person from the pool or open water. That extraction process is physically demanding and must be done correctly. A victim pulled from the water carelessly can sustain or worsen a spinal injury, turning a survivable incident into something far worse.

Once the victim is on the pool deck, the environment still presents challenges. Hard surfaces, wet conditions, bystanders crowding in, and the need to coordinate with other staff all create pressure that a classroom manikin exercise does not fully replicate. Standard CPR certification covers the fundamentals of compression and ventilation, but it does not prepare a rescuer for the chaos and physical demands that precede those fundamentals in an aquatic emergency. That is precisely why CPR training for lifeguards is a distinct and more comprehensive skill set, not simply a rebranded version of what anyone can take at a community center.

Which CPR and BLS Certifications Do Lifeguards Actually Need?

Not all CPR certifications are created equal, and for lifeguards, the level of certification matters enormously. A basic consumer-level course, such as the American Heart Association's Heartsaver CPR AED program, is designed for laypeople who want to be prepared to help in an emergency. It is a valuable credential for the general public, but it does not meet the standard for most regulated aquatic facilities.

Lifeguards at professional facilities are typically required to hold either CPR for Professional Rescuers or BLS certification. These programs are meaningfully different from entry-level courses. They cover two-rescuer CPR, which is highly relevant in aquatic settings where a second lifeguard or first responder may be available. They include bag-mask ventilation technique, which is a skill that goes beyond mouth-to-mouth rescue breathing. And they incorporate AED use at a higher skill level, with more emphasis on real-world decision-making under pressure.

The two primary certifying bodies whose credentials are widely recognized by employers and accrediting organizations are the American Heart Association and the American Red Cross. The AHA's BLS course and the Red Cross's CPR/AED for Professional Rescuers and Health Care Providers are the most relevant programs for lifeguards in active duty roles. Both are accepted by most aquatic employers, but facility managers should verify which specific certification their state regulations or facility accreditation standards require before assuming either will suffice.

State requirements vary more than many people realize. Some states have specific regulations governing lifeguard certification through their department of health or parks and recreation oversight bodies. Facilities affiliated with organizations such as the YMCA, USA Swimming, or municipal parks departments may have certification requirements layered on top of state minimums, meaning the floor for compliance is higher than the general standard.

For lifeguards working at facilities that serve children, including pools, water parks, and summer camps, pediatric CPR credentials add another important dimension. Infant and child anatomy differs from adult anatomy in ways that affect compression depth, ventilation volume, and rescue breathing technique. A lifeguard who has only practiced adult CPR may not be fully prepared to respond to a pediatric submersion incident. Facilities serving younger populations should ensure their lifeguard teams hold certifications that explicitly cover pediatric scenarios in addition to adult CPR protocols.

What the Coursework Actually Covers

Knowing which certification to pursue is one thing. Understanding what you will actually learn and practice in a lifeguard CPR course helps set realistic expectations and underscores why hands-on training cannot be replaced by an online video.

The core technical skills in any professional rescuer CPR course center on chest compression quality and rescue breathing. This means learning the correct compression depth and rate, understanding how to achieve a proper seal for rescue breathing, and developing the physical coordination to maintain consistent compressions over time. These skills are practiced on manikins specifically to build muscle memory, because in a real emergency, a rescuer should not be thinking about hand placement. That knowledge needs to be automatic.

Two-rescuer CPR is a particularly important component for lifeguards. When two trained rescuers are present, they can share the physical workload of compressions and ventilations, which improves the quality of CPR over time and reduces fatigue. Coordinating a smooth handoff between rescuers without interrupting compressions is a practiced skill, not something that comes naturally under pressure. Professional rescuer courses train this coordination explicitly.

AED operation is another core element. Lifeguards need to know how to deploy an AED quickly, how to operate it correctly while CPR is ongoing, and how to integrate AED use into a two-rescuer scenario without losing momentum. Many facilities have AEDs mounted in specific locations, and lifeguards should be familiar with the exact model at their facility, not just the general concept of how AEDs work.

Spinal injury management during water extraction is a skill set that sets lifeguard CPR training apart from general professional rescuer courses. Moving a victim incorrectly during extraction can cause or worsen a spinal injury, particularly in diving incidents or situations where the mechanism of injury is unclear. Lifeguard training programs address how to stabilize the head and neck during extraction, how to use backboards and other equipment, and when spinal precautions are warranted based on the circumstances of the incident.

Scenario-based drills round out the coursework by putting all of these individual skills together in simulated pool-deck emergencies. These drills are where lifeguards practice decision-making under pressure, not just isolated technique. A scenario might involve a victim who is unresponsive and not breathing after a submersion, requiring the lifeguard to manage the extraction, call for backup, begin CPR, deploy an AED, and communicate with arriving emergency services, all in a compressed and stressful timeframe. This kind of practice is what separates trained readiness from theoretical knowledge.

Certification Renewal: Staying Current Is Not Optional

CPR certification for lifeguards does not last indefinitely. Both the American Heart Association and the American Red Cross issue certifications that are valid for two years. After that point, the credential expires and the lifeguard is no longer considered currently certified, regardless of how long they have been working or how confident they feel in their skills.

Most employers require proof of a current, valid certification at all times, meaning a lifeguard whose credential has lapsed should not be scheduled on deck until they have completed renewal. This is not bureaucratic caution. It is a straightforward liability issue. If an incident occurs and a lifeguard on duty holds an expired certification, the facility faces significant legal and regulatory exposure. Some states have specific regulations that make this exposure even more concrete, with penalties for facilities that allow uncertified staff to serve in lifeguard roles.

Renewal courses are shorter than initial certification courses, which makes the process more manageable for working lifeguards and their employers. However, shorter does not mean easier or less rigorous in terms of what is evaluated. Renewal still requires hands-on skills verification, meaning a lifeguard must demonstrate competency in compressions, ventilation, two-rescuer coordination, and AED use in front of a certified instructor. This is an important distinction because fully online-only renewal options are generally not sufficient for lifeguards in active duty roles. An online component may be part of a blended renewal course, but the hands-on skills check cannot be skipped or replaced by a video.

Facility managers who want to avoid the scramble of last-minute renewals should build a certification tracking system that flags upcoming expiration dates well in advance. Waiting until a credential has already lapsed creates unnecessary scheduling gaps and puts the facility at risk. Planning renewal sessions into the operational calendar, ideally before peak season, keeps the entire team current without disruption.

Group CPR Training: A Smarter Approach for Aquatic Facilities

For aquatic facilities with multiple lifeguards on staff, sending each person to an individual certification course offsite is rarely the most efficient or cost-effective approach. Group CPR training, where a certified instructor comes directly to the facility, offers meaningful advantages in terms of both logistics and training quality.

The logistical benefits are straightforward. Scheduling a group session eliminates the coordination burden of tracking multiple individual enrollments at different locations on different dates. It reduces the time staff spend traveling to and from training sites. And it often reduces the per-person cost of certification, particularly for larger teams.

The training quality benefits are equally significant. When a lifeguard team trains together at their own facility, they practice on familiar ground. They use the AED models that are actually mounted on their walls. They work through scenario drills on the specific pool deck where they will respond to real emergencies. This environmental familiarity builds a kind of contextual readiness that offsite training cannot fully replicate.

Group training also creates consistency across the team. When every lifeguard on the roster has practiced the same protocols, used the same equipment, and participated in the same scenario drills, there is a shared language and a shared standard of response. In a real emergency involving multiple staff members, that consistency matters. Two-rescuer CPR coordination, for example, works better when both rescuers have trained together and know each other's timing and habits.

Facility managers should think carefully about when to schedule group training sessions. Aquatic facilities often operate on seasonal staffing cycles, with a surge in hiring before summer or before an indoor season opens. Planning certification and renewal sessions in the weeks before peak season ensures that every lifeguard on the roster is current from the first day the facility opens to the public. This is far preferable to discovering mid-season that several staff members need to renew, which forces difficult scheduling decisions and potential compliance gaps.

Building a CPR-Ready Lifeguard Team That Stays Ready

Getting your lifeguard team certified is the starting point, not the finish line. A strong aquatic safety program treats CPR training as an ongoing operational priority, not a one-time hire requirement that gets checked off and forgotten.

Regular in-service drills between certification cycles help lifeguards retain the skills they learned in their formal courses. Muscle memory fades without practice. A team that completed CPR certification eight months ago and has not run a scenario drill since is less prepared than a team that completed certification at the same time and has drilled monthly. Building short, structured practice sessions into the regular schedule does not require a full certification course. It requires intentional leadership and a commitment to readiness as a team value.

Certification tracking is a non-negotiable administrative function for any facility with lifeguards on staff. Every active lifeguard's certification expiration date should be documented, monitored, and flagged well before the renewal deadline. A simple spreadsheet can serve this function, though dedicated workforce management tools make it easier to automate reminders and maintain records for compliance audits. The goal is simple: no lifeguard should ever be scheduled on deck with an expired credential.
